Mangaluru: 3 days Jeevan Jyothi camp for 10th standard students of Mangalore City deanery was held at St Joseph’s Engineering College Vamanjoor from October 3. Various relevant topics on spiritual and personality development were addressed. Likewise, group dynamics and motivational inputs added flavour to the Jeevan Jyothi camp. 220 students of Mangalore City deanery were present. Rev Father James Dsouza the Deen was present at the inaugural as well as the concluding program. Rev Father Peter Gonsalves the cordinator and all the Junior clergy of the city deanery shared various responsibilities along with volunteers from the deanery.
